>I do have backups running nightly for the database, but trying to walk
>the tech coord through the steps via the phone when he is being pressured
>by teachers/etc is not a fun thing. I wouldn't have an issue with
>resetting the database from the backups, but not something I want to try
>remotely just yet.
Why? Doing it remotely is exactly the same as doing it
locally....especially if you're using a terminal or PuTTY and doing it
with CLI. I usually skip the phone call and just ask for root access so I
can do it myself. (Then I ask them to change the root password back to
something else when done) Seriously though....don't be afraid to reset
the ldap database remotely....it's not big deal. :-)
